The Faran HR-DHTC is a digital humidistat and thermostat for measuring and controlling relative humidity and temperature. It has two separate outputs: one for humidity control and one for temperature control. This allows one humidity function and one temperature function to be controlled simultaneously.
The function of each output is determined by the selected operating mode. The humidity output can be configured for humidifying or dehumidifying. The temperature output can be configured for heating or cooling.

Humidifying and dehumidifying cannot be controlled simultaneously because both functions use the same humidity output. Likewise, heating and cooling cannot operate simultaneously because they use the same temperature output.
The switching differential can be configured separately for temperature and humidity control. It determines how far the measured value must deviate from the selected setting before the corresponding output switches.
The HR-DHTC also has an adjustable output delay of 0 to 999 seconds. This can prevent connected equipment from restarting too quickly in response to small or short-term changes in the measured value.
Please note: each output can switch a maximum of 2.2 amps. Do not connect an appliance drawing a higher current directly to the controller. Use a suitable external contactor for appliances with a higher load or high inrush current, such as motors and compressors. Always check the current rating on the appliance rating plate.
